Transaction 908091d40e336cbfc5a5acaae229ae732bcfcda50894dd3ebafdce48136330c9

1 Input
2 Outputs
  • 908091d40e336cbfc5a5acaae229ae732bcfcda50894dd3ebafdce48136330c9:0
  • value  3545978
    address  3FuAEAAiWHTP7wEboHm9dXZHUmsLyyJuVt
  • 908091d40e336cbfc5a5acaae229ae732bcfcda50894dd3ebafdce48136330c9:1
  • value  2690498
    address  16K4N2g5TCUJizg32isTcFMbPW2CgKUn6R